    probably cheaper to get em yourself. plugs/wire you can get at any autozone/advance/Orielys.

    Dizzy cap and Rotor I'd get off ebay or from the above mentioned.

    Everything else, same place.

    If I were you, I'd do the most I had time for by myself, it'll save you money on Labor. Like do the plugs and wires yourself. and dizzy and rotor if you know how. then all the shop can charge for is Head gasket/belt/pump.

    Oh and its always good to check/clean your air filter when your doing a normal tune up.

    ok first off not even in a major tune up is a head gasket included. is your head gasket blown? do u have low comp? funky looking oil/coolant? if u answer no to those a head gasket isnt needed.

    i can tell u this the only way your going to come in under 400 is u do the work yourself. labor is is going to range from 400-900 depending on where u go. parts about $250 depending on there markup. most shops wont warranty there work if they dont get the parts.
